Nestled in the mountains of Western North Carolina is beautiful Lake Chatuge. In 1942, the TVA constructed a 2,950 foot earthfill dam across the Hiawassee River, forming Lake Chatuge. Visitors enjoy leisurelyy strolls along the dam with its spectacular view of the lake and surrounding mountains. With over 130 miles of shoreling, the lake has numerous fingerlike projections of land forming interesting coves for great fishing, swimming, boating, and water sports.
